Performing the Home

August 18 - August 31, 2016. A site-specific, experiential art exhibit at the Nave Gallery Annex in Davis Square, Somerville, MA in the Boston area. Big thanks to all of the artists, artists' friends, and Nave Gallery volunteers who helped install, deinstall and gallery sit for the show. We could not have done it without you! Performing the Past | Performing the Past

Skip to primary content. Skip to secondary content. Reflections on the Workshops. Welcome to Performing the Past. October 2, 2012. A new collaborative research network between the Universities of Sheffield, York and Leeds funded by the White Rose University Consortium. Bringing together archaeology, history, literature, film studies, theatre, performance and museum studies. Between September 2012 and May 2013 will explore themes such as:. Narrative traditions of working class communities.
